From 23ea0e75080e427e5ec6be08f7fa75fc8508cd94 Mon Sep 17 00:00:00 2001 From: Claire Date: Wed, 16 Nov 2022 20:56:06 +0100 Subject: [PATCH] Add aria-label and title attributes to local settings navigation items (#1949) --- .../glitch/features/local_settings/navigation/item/index.js |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/app/javascript/flavours/glitch/features/local_settings/navigation/item/index.js b/app/javascript/flavours/glitch/features/local_settings/navigation/item/index.js index 4dec7d154..739c5ebae 100644 --- a/app/javascript/flavours/glitch/features/local_settings/navigation/item/index.js +++ b/app/javascript/flavours/glitch/features/local_settings/navigation/item/index.js @@ -50,6 +50,8 @@ export default class LocalSettingsPage extends React.PureComponent { {iconElem} {title} @@ -60,6 +62,8 @@ export default class LocalSettingsPage extends React.PureComponent { role='button' tabIndex='0' className={finalClassName} + title={title} + aria-label={title} > {iconElem} {title}